Espresso: Pioneering Blockchain Scalability and Interconnectivity

Introduction: Espresso’s Game-Changing Vision

At KBW on August 24, Block Media’s editor Jung Yoon-jae conducted an exclusive interview with Ben Fisch, co-founder and CEO of Espresso. Fisch introduced Espresso as a revolutionary blockchain infrastructure designed to transform fragmented ecosystems, accelerate transaction finality, and bridge the divide between the Web2 and Web3 landscapes.

“Espresso delivers transaction finality speeds up to 1,000 times faster than Ethereum while offering a unified blockchain ecosystem that breaks barriers between Web2 and Web3,” Fisch explained, emphasizing the platform’s potential to redefine blockchain scalability and efficiency.

The Origins of Espresso

"I’m Ben Fisch, the co-founder and CEO of Espresso," Fisch shared, recounting the platform’s journey. "Espresso began five years ago while I was completing my Ph.D. at Stanford University. I currently serve as a professor at Yale University and have been involved in protocol developments such as Filecoin (FIL) and Chia (XCH), as well as research initiatives enhancing Ethereum."

Fisch highlighted Espresso’s mission to fulfill Web3’s true vision by unifying payment systems and digital asset exchanges into an interoperable ecosystem. “Web3, similar to Web2, remains fragmented today,” he remarked. “Espresso is the breakthrough technology aimed at solving this issue.”

Solving Fragmentation and Privacy in Blockchain

Initially, Espresso was conceived as a private payment application that complied with regulations while safeguarding transaction privacy. Fisch highlighted the importance of confidentiality for the mainstream adoption of stablecoin payments, stating that “a fully public ledger cannot meet these needs.”

However, during development, the larger issue of blockchain ecosystem fragmentation became apparent. “This fragmented environment discourages user adoption of innovative payment systems operating across separate chains,” Fisch noted. Espresso refocused its mission to tackle fragmentation while retaining its emphasis on privacy.

Rollup-Centric Approach: Rethinking Blockchain Architecture

Espresso’s design was driven by the question: “What if Ethereum had been designed for rollups from the start?” Fisch explained that Ethereum adopted rollups later to address scalability challenges but suggested its design would differ had rollups been fundamental from the outset.

“To achieve true scalability, blockchain infrastructure must offload the complexity of executing elaborate smart contracts and instead prioritize foundational tasks like receiving, ordering, and providing universal access to data,” Fisch elaborated. He likened Ethereum’s "blobspace," an optimized rollup data storage area, to Espresso’s more advanced implementation.

Speed and Security via Decentralized Sequencing and BFT Consensus

Espresso leverages decentralized sequencing and a Byzantine Fault Tolerance (BFT) consensus mechanism to boost rollup efficiency. Fisch detailed how these features provide rollups with Ethereum-level security while delivering unmatched transaction speeds.

“Ethereum achieves finality in approximately 15 minutes, but Espresso reduces this to mere seconds—and plans to achieve finality in under one second moving forward,” he revealed. Espresso's innovative consensus protocol sidesteps the overhead of processing smart contracts, streamlining data handling to ensure rapid and scalable transaction finality.

Cross-Chain Real-Time Confirmation: Bridging Web2 and Web3

Espresso’s ability to enable cross-chain real-time confirmations is a transformative feature for developers and users alike. Fisch explained how traditional Web2 platforms can integrate seamlessly into Web3 by uploading data directly to Espresso.

“For instance, payment systems like Naver Pay or Samsung Pay could use Espresso’s infrastructure to communicate cross-system without complexity,” Fisch illustrated. “Imagine payment confirmation messages from Samsung Pay engaging with other blockchain systems instantly—Espresso becomes a unifying conduit for web applications, enabling real-time integration.”

Enabling New Applications: The Power of Espresso

Beyond incremental blockchain improvements, Espresso lays the groundwork for entirely new applications. Fisch likened its potential to that of the internet’s ability to enable seamless information exchanges and added, “Espresso will revolutionize value exchanges on a global scale.”

One standout possibility is the concept of a cross-chain universal order book. Currently, liquidity in exchanges like Nasdaq, Shanghai, or Korea remains segregated. Espresso’s real-time connectivity could consolidate all chains into a singular liquidity pool, eliminating traditional exchange structures.

"You could sell an asset on one chain and instantly match with a buyer across the globe on another chain," Fisch envisioned. “This innovation would render platforms like Binance, Coinbase, and Upbit obsolete, creating a unified global marketplace.”

Roadmap: Integration as the Core Focus

Espresso’s roadmap prioritizes integration with multiple blockchain networks. “We recently integrated with Apechain and partnered with Arbitrum (ARB) to develop a dedicated integration module, which we plan to propose to Arbitrum’s DAO,” Fisch disclosed.

Additionally, Espresso is working on integrations with chains like Polygon (POL) AggLayer and Celo (CELO). Fisch outlined Espresso’s encouragement for developers to build applications utilizing its cross-chain messaging capabilities, citing the universal order book as one example of this innovation.
